What Is an RO System and Why Is It Essential for Your Aquarium?

A Reverse Osmosis (RO) system is a water purification technology that utilizes a semipermeable membrane to remove impurities from water, including dissolved solids, chemicals, and microorganisms. In the context of aquariums, an RO system is essential for providing clean, pure water that mimics natural aquatic environments, thereby promoting the health and vitality of aquatic life.

According to the U.S. Environmental Protection Agency (EPA), reverse osmosis is a widely accepted method for improving water quality by reducing contaminants and total dissolved solids (TDS) (EPA, 2021). This purification process allows aquarists to control the water chemistry, which is crucial for maintaining a stable environment for fish and plants.

Key aspects of an RO system include its multi-stage filtration process, typically involving sediment filters, carbon filters, and the RO membrane itself. Sediment filters remove larger particles, while carbon filters eliminate chlorine and other organic compounds. The RO membrane then effectively removes up to 99% of dissolved solids, heavy metals, and other harmful substances. Many systems also include a remineralization stage, which adds essential minerals back into the water, ensuring it is suitable for aquatic life.

The impact of using an RO system in aquariums cannot be overstated. For freshwater aquariums, untreated tap water can introduce harmful chemicals like chlorine and chloramine, which can stress or harm fish. In saltwater systems, high levels of nitrates and phosphates can lead to algal blooms and compromised health of corals and invertebrates. The use of an RO system minimizes these risks, resulting in a healthier, more stable aquarium environment.

Statistics show that aquarists who utilize RO systems often experience improved water clarity and reduced algae growth. Many hobbyists report a decrease in fish mortality rates and an increase in breeding success when using purified water, illustrating the significant benefits of RO systems for aquarium health.

To ensure the effectiveness of an RO system, best practices include regular maintenance, such as replacing filters and membranes as recommended by the manufacturer. Monitoring water quality through TDS meters can help aquarists determine when to replace components. Additionally, it’s advisable to consider the specific needs of the aquarium inhabitants when selecting an RO system, with options available that vary in capacity and filtration stages to accommodate different setups.

What Key Features Should You Look For in an RO System?

When selecting the best RO system for an aquarium, several key features should be considered to ensure optimal water quality.

  • Filtration Stages: A good RO system typically includes multiple filtration stages, such as pre-filters, reverse osmosis membranes, and post-filters. Each stage plays a crucial role in removing contaminants, ensuring that the water is safe for your aquatic life.
  • Water Production Rate: The efficiency of the system is often measured by its water production rate, usually expressed in gallons per day (GPD). A higher GPD rating means the system can produce more purified water in a shorter time, which is beneficial for larger aquariums or frequent water changes.
  • Waste-to-Product Ratio: This ratio indicates how much wastewater is produced compared to the amount of purified water generated. A lower waste-to-product ratio is more efficient, conserving water and reducing costs, making it a vital factor for environmentally conscious aquarium owners.
  • Compatibility with Additional Filters: Some RO systems allow for the installation of additional filters, such as deionization (DI) filters. This compatibility can further enhance water purity, especially for sensitive species that require ultra-pure water conditions.
  • Ease of Installation and Maintenance: An easy-to-install and maintain RO system can save time and effort. Look for systems with clear instructions, easily accessible filter replacements, and features that simplify routine maintenance tasks.
  • Size and Design: The physical dimensions and design of the RO system should fit comfortably in your designated space, whether it’s under the sink or in a dedicated area. Compact designs are often preferred for home use, but consideration should also be given to the system’s aesthetic appeal.
  • Pressure and Temperature Tolerance: An effective RO system should operate efficiently under varying water pressure and temperature conditions. Systems with a wider tolerance range can adapt to different household water supplies, ensuring consistent performance.

How Does Membrane Quality Affect Your RO System’s Performance?

  • Pore Size: The effectiveness of an RO membrane is largely determined by its pore size, typically around 0.0001 microns. This small size allows it to filter out most contaminants, including dissolved salts, heavy metals, and microorganisms, ensuring that the water quality is suitable for sensitive aquarium inhabitants.
  • Material Composition: RO membranes are usually made from polyamide thin-film composite materials, which provide durability and resistance to fouling. A high-quality membrane will have better chemical resistance and longevity, reducing the frequency of replacements and maintaining consistent water purity over time.
  • Rejection Rate: The rejection rate of a membrane indicates how effectively it can remove impurities from the water. A membrane with a high rejection rate ensures that more contaminants are filtered out, leading to cleaner water that supports the health of fish and plants in an aquarium environment.
  • Flow Rate: The flow rate of an RO system is influenced by the membrane’s quality; higher quality membranes can allow for better water flow without sacrificing purification. This is particularly important for aquarists who need a reliable supply of filtered water to maintain stable water conditions in their tanks.
  • Durability: Membrane durability affects not only the lifespan of the RO system but also its overall efficiency. A more robust membrane will be less prone to damage from chlorine, chloramines, and other harsh chemicals, which can prolong the system’s functionality and reduce maintenance costs.

What Maintenance Practices Will Keep Your RO System Running Efficiently?

To keep your reverse osmosis (RO) system running efficiently, consider the following maintenance practices:

  • Regular Filter Replacement: It’s essential to replace the pre-filters and post-filters according to the manufacturer’s recommendations, typically every 6 to 12 months. These filters capture sediments and impurities, ensuring that the RO membrane works effectively and prolonging its life.
  • Membrane Cleaning: Cleaning the RO membrane periodically can prevent fouling and scaling, which can significantly reduce water production and quality. Depending on the water quality, cleaning should be done every 1 to 2 years using a specialized cleaning solution to maintain optimal performance.
  • Monitor Water Pressure: Maintaining the appropriate water pressure is crucial for the efficiency of an RO system. Regularly check the pressure using a gauge, as low pressure can hinder performance, while excessively high pressure can damage the system.
  • Sanitization: Regularly sanitizing the entire RO system, including the storage tank, helps prevent bacterial growth and contamination. This process should be done at least once a year using food-grade hydrogen peroxide or other recommended sanitizing agents.
  • Check for Leaks: Inspect all connections and tubing for leaks or wear regularly. Even small leaks can lead to significant water loss and reduce the system’s efficiency over time, so addressing them promptly is vital.
  • Water Quality Testing: Regular testing of the output water quality ensures that the RO system is effectively removing impurities. Using a TDS (Total Dissolved Solids) meter can help you monitor the system’s performance and determine when maintenance is needed.
  • System Flush: Flushing the system periodically helps remove any build-up of contaminants and maintains optimal flow rates. This process can be done by running the system without using the water for a short period, usually once every few months, to keep it in top condition.

What Common Misconceptions Exist About RO Systems for Aquariums?

Common misconceptions about reverse osmosis (RO) systems for aquariums can affect how aquarium enthusiasts choose and maintain their systems.

  • RO Systems Remove All Essential Minerals: Many believe that RO systems strip water of all minerals, making it unsuitable for fish. However, while RO systems do remove a majority of impurities and minerals, they do not eliminate the ability to remineralize water using additives designed for aquariums, allowing hobbyists to maintain safe and healthy conditions for their aquatic life.
  • RO Water Is Unnecessary for Freshwater Aquariums: Some aquarists think that RO water is only beneficial for saltwater setups. In reality, using RO water in freshwater aquariums helps to create a stable and clean environment, especially in tanks with sensitive fish or plants that thrive in low TDS (total dissolved solids) conditions.
  • All RO Systems Are the Same: There is a misconception that all RO systems provide the same level of purification. In fact, RO systems can vary in quality, filtration stages, and outputs, making it crucial to choose one that is specifically designed for aquarium use to ensure optimal water quality.
  • RO Water Is Expensive to Produce: Many believe that using an RO system is cost-prohibitive due to the waste water produced. While it is true that RO systems can waste some water during purification, advancements in technology have led to more efficient models that minimize waste, making them an economical choice in the long run.
  • RO Systems Require Constant Maintenance: There’s a belief that RO systems need excessive maintenance and frequent filter changes. In reality, regular maintenance, including periodic filter replacements and sanitization, is relatively straightforward and can be scheduled based on the volume of water processed, making them manageable for most aquarium owners.
